There are a number of ways for a SP game to have replay value besides multiplayer:
Have a botzone like those in Battlefield 2 (PC), KZ2, and KZ3.
Have a single battle skirmish mode (player vs computer) like in the Total War games, mamy RTS games, and most sports games.
In open-world games, have free explore. In the case of Far Cry 3, there's also the option to reset outposts. The latter has taken all my spare time to the detriment of all other games from 2013.
Customized missions like in many flight sims.
In-game game editor to create customized scenarios like the one in ARMA 2.
